G2 3469 is a Mediterranean-style residence providing 3,469 square feet of heated living space across two levels. Measuring 80 feet 8 inches in width and 59 feet 8 inches in depth, this home is engineered for coastal lots that accommodate a wide footprint. The exterior features a stucco finish supported by a durable CMU wall framing system, contributing to a total building height of 33 feet 9 inches.
The 2,515 square foot main level centers on an open-concept great room that anchors the living area. The layout incorporates a primary suite with a dedicated walk-in closet and a split-bedroom configuration to ensure privacy between the primary wing and the secondary bedrooms. A home office and a self-contained in-law suite are integrated into the floor plan, providing flexibility for multi-generational living or remote work requirements. The kitchen is equipped with a central island and an eating bar, facilitating direct sightlines into the main living zone.
The 954 square foot second level expands the living area with a loft space that opens onto a balcony. This upper level provides a secondary vantage point for the surrounding environment while maintaining a clear separation from the primary social areas on the first floor. The two-story foyer creates a vertical connection between levels, enhancing the distribution of natural light throughout the interior core.
Construction specifications include a stemwall foundation and a truss-framed roof system with a 6:12 roof pitch. The design prioritizes outdoor living with a 633 square foot lanai, a rear porch, and an outdoor kitchen, allowing for climate-responsive usage. A 111 square foot front porch provides a formal point of entry.
The home includes an 853 square foot front-entry three-car garage, providing vehicle storage and utility access without obstructing the rear living areas. This configuration ensures consistent driveway utility while maintaining the proportions of the Mediterranean exterior profile.

Choose a building foundation for your home. The foundation provides stability to a home's structure from the ground up.
Slab - This concrete foundation is reinforced with steel rods and suitable for flat ground.
Crawl Space - This foundation is raised off the ground with low walls resting on footings, providing space for wiring, plumbing, and storage.
Basement - This foundation is entirely or partially below ground and offers storage or living areas.
Walkout Basement - This foundation is typically suited for rear-sloping lots and provides storage or living areas. Walkout basements have doors that provide access to the outside.
